How are the priorities of caBIG® established?

0

caBIG® development began with a survey of NCI-designated comprehensive cancer centers to determine their top priorities. The survey demonstrated the breadth of the needs of the oncology community – a breadth that caBIG® has been designed to accommodate. Specific caBIG® areas, or workspaces, were identified through this community input. The workspaces continue to generate priorities for the initiative, so that caBIG® can focus on the needs of the community. The priorities of the individual workspaces are expressed in workspace strategic plans, which are integrated into the caBIG® strategic plan. Additionally, the NCI identifies areas where caBIG® can contribute.
